Skip to content

Commit 485dafc

Browse files
committed
Sync NetworkServiceMock
1 parent 3bd1831 commit 485dafc

File tree

1 file changed

+1
-14
lines changed

1 file changed

+1
-14
lines changed

Source/NetworkServices/NetworkServiceMock.swift

Lines changed: 1 addition &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-62,20 +62,6 @@ import Foundation
6262
*/
6363
public final class NetworkServiceMock: NetworkService, @unchecked Sendable {
6464

65-
public enum Error: Swift.Error, CustomDebugStringConvertible {
66-
case missingRequest
67-
case typeMismatch
68-
69-
public var debugDescription: String {
70-
switch self {
71-
case .missingRequest:
72-
return "Could not return because no request"
73-
case .typeMismatch:
74-
return "Return type does not match requested type"
75-
}
76-
}
77-
}
78-
7965
/// Count of all started requests
8066
public var requestCount: Int {
8167
return lastRequests.count
@@ -147,6 +133,7 @@ public final class NetworkServiceMock: NetworkService, @unchecked Sendable {
147133
- parameter onError: Callback which gets called when fetching or transforming fails.
148134

149135
*/
136+
@MainActor
150137
public func requestResultWithResponse<Success>(for resource: Resource<Success, NetworkError>) async -> Result<(Success, HTTPURLResponse), NetworkError> {
151138
lastRequests.append(resource.request)
152139
if !responses.isEmpty {

0 commit comments

Comments
 (0)